Mid Century Modern Farmhouse Dining Room Table

The dining table is the centerpiece of any dining room, and in a mid century modern farmhouse design, it should be both functional and stylish. Look for a dining table with clean lines and a simple silhouette, such as a rectangular or round shape. A wooden table with a natural finish or a distressed look would be the perfect addition to a farmhouse dining room. You can also opt for a combination of materials, such as a wooden top with metal legs, for a more modern twist.

Mid Century Modern Farmhouse Dining Room Lighting

The right lighting can make all the difference in a dining room, and in a mid century modern farmhouse design, you'll want to choose fixtures that are both functional and stylish. A statement chandelier in a sleek and modern design can add a touch of elegance and visual interest to the room. For more farmhouse charm, consider incorporating some vintage-inspired pendant lights or a rustic chandelier made of wood and metal. And don't forget to add in some table lamps or floor lamps for softer ambient lighting.

Key Elements of a Mid Century Modern Farmhouse Dining Room

Mid Century Modern Farmhouse Dining Room To achieve the perfect mid century modern farmhouse dining room, there are a few key elements that need to be incorporated. First and foremost, the furniture should be a blend of modern and rustic pieces. This can include a mix of clean-lined chairs and a rustic farmhouse table. Lighting is also an important element in this style, with pendant lights or chandeliers made from natural materials such as wood or metal being a popular choice. Neutral colors are also a staple in this style, with white, beige, and gray being commonly used to create a clean and airy feel.
